Kok‐Sing Lim is a leading researcher in the fields of fiber optic sensing, flexible haptics, and bionic intelligent robotics. His most notable contribution is the development of three-dimensional force-tactile sensors that integrate dual fiber Bragg gratings (FBGs) within anisotropic materials, enabling precise, multi-axis force detection for human–computer interaction and robotic applications. This innovative work, published in 2023 and already garnering 9 citations, demonstrates his ability to merge advanced photonics with biomimetic design. Lim’s research addresses critical challenges in creating flexible, high-resolution haptic interfaces, with potential impacts on prosthetics, soft robotics, and wearable technology.
